My age is 27, weight is 88 kg. My urine output has reduced. My creatinine blood level is 0.98. Is it normal?

I have reviewed your health query and can understand your concerns. Your creatinine levels are not abnormal in this laboratory result (attachment removed to protect patient identity). The results are from a reliable laboratory and show you are well within the normal range of creatinine levels. No issues diagnosed based on the lab results. But clinical correlation is also important here. You complained of reduced urine output. There are a lot of reasons for that. The first thing you need to take care of is your daily fluid intake amount. If that is not up to the mark, improve that first. Take more vegetables and fruits and avoid meat and chicken. No fried and fast foods or junk calories. Avoid soft drinks.
As far as your medication is concerned, Singulair has no side effects that may have affected your urine output. It is a safe medication to be taken for many reasons. If this does not help, please consult a local physician with the advantage of physical examination and proper evaluation. If needed, he may also refer you to a kidney doctor.
